Local home sales remain hot in May
Red Deer’s residential real estate market continued its torrid pace last month with home sales in May far outpacing numbers seen in the same month over the previous four years.
According to the latest market report from Central Alberta Realtors Association, there were 197 home sales in Red Deer last month, way up from 75 units sold in May of 2020, and the previous five-year high of 152 home sales in May 2017.
Year-to-date numbers are also significantly higher, with 842 home sales in Red Deer through the fist five months of this year, compared with 385 homes sales at the same point in 2020.
The average sale price last month was $348,752 – up substantially from $299,949 in May 2020.
